It’s wonderful to rise here today to recognize the outstanding work of the general manager of the Stratford and District Chamber of Commerce, Eddie Matthews. He recently announced that he will be retiring from the chamber. I’ve had the privilege of working with Eddie in his capacity as general manager during my time as a member in this assembly for Perth–Wellington, and even before I arrived in this place.

Eddie is a diligent and hard-working individual who always has the best interests of our business community at heart.

Eddie has been with the chamber for the past five years, and during his time as general manager, he endured tough challenges during the COVID-19 pandemic, completely reworking the chamber, how they ran their key events, and he was there for our small businesses as they dealt with those challenges. He was there to support our local businesses in good times and bad. He has played a key role in expanding the chamber of commerce membership beyond Stratford and into the area of West Perth and St. Marys.

Speaker, before Eddie was even general manager of the chamber, he had a long and successful career in radio. And I know in whatever he does next, he will succeed again.

I would like to sincerely extend my gratitude to Eddie for all of his service and leadership to our community.

I wish you all the best in your next chapter with Lori.

Earlier this fall, I had the opportunity to attend the Stratford Optimism Place women’s shelter 40th anniversary celebrations. Optimism Place provides an integral service to our community. They offer shelter, counselling and protection for women and children in abusive or precarious situations.

At their anniversary celebrations, they also marked the official ground-breaking ceremony of their 7,000-square-foot, 18-bed expansion project. This expansion project will add 10 new bedrooms, seven new washrooms, three laundry rooms, a new playground, two counselling offices, a multi-purpose meeting space and a kitchenette. Through private donors, government and in-kind support, they’ve already raised 80% of their $5-million capital budget.

I’m pleased to announce they also received over $100,000 through the Ontario Trillium Foundation Resilient Communities Fund. They plan to use this funding to support additional staff, programming and the development of an Optimism social enterprise initiative. This physical expansion and the new social enterprise initiative will allow Optimism Place to help more women and children in our communities.

Congratulations, again, to Jasmine and the entire team. Thank you for everything you do in our community.
